She received an interdisciplinary bachelor\u2019s degree from the University of South Carolina in biology, psychology, public health, and environmental studies. She completed her Master\u2019s of Public Health in the Department of Environmental Health at Emory University\u2019s Rollins School of Public Health. Her research interests include environmental epidemiology, climate adaptation and mitigation planning, connections between the built environment and health, and environmental justice. Her favorite place in Boston is the Arnold Arboretum.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"author":19744,"template":"","_links":{"self":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.bu.edu\/ioc\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/profile\/20442"}],"collection":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.bu.edu\/ioc\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/profile"}],"about":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.bu.edu\/ioc\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/types\/profile"}],"author":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.bu.edu\/ioc\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/users\/19744"}],"version-history":[{"count":1,"href":"https:\/\/www.bu.edu\/ioc\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/profile\/20442\/revisions"}],"predecessor-version":[{"id":20443,"href":"https:\/\/www.bu.edu\/ioc\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/profile\/20442\/revisions\/20443"}],"wp:attachment":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.bu.edu\/ioc\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media?parent=20442"}],"curies":[{"name":"wp","href":"https:\/\/api.w.org\/{rel}","templated":true}]}}
